IP查询
查询
你查询的IP:[118.24.13.196] 地理位置:中国–四川–成都
最新查询
220.231.221.27
58.24.132.246
218.237.230.72
121.40.136.52
134.196.24.67
202.93.195.58
117.44.128.146
123.244.103.65
119.128.17.235
118.24.13.196
61.45.128.93
222.160.224.31
198.17.7.193
121.204.65.74
123.138.74.39
125.58.128.111
202.180.128.255
58.16.44.168
119.42.82.232
121.224.135.138
221.8.245.236
202.91.176.48
58.66.126.219
123.144.224.164
203.208.16.197
219.216.220.229
125.213.2.166
117.21.72.172
122.152.192.249
202.130.224.36
124.126.46.184